Two members of Siena Women's Track Team fit in one last competition before the MAAC Outdoor Track and Field Championships next weekend.
Claire Gardner continued to rewrite the history books when doing so as the senior finished the 800-meter in record time of 2:10.56 for an 11th overall finish at the Larry Ellison Invitational at Princeton University on Friday.Â
Her teammate
Keira Flaherty wasn't far behind and she closed in 2:11.50 for a 13th place spot in the same event.Â
Flaherty's time was the second fastest outdoor time in program history. Â
This comes off heels of Gardner winning the women's 400-meter with a school-record time of 57.74 at the Capital District Classic just one week earlier. Â
"They both had phenomenal days," said Siena Track head coach
Elizabeth DeBole.Â
"The goal was to get into a good situation and really commit the second half. Both did that and can go into the MAAC Championship believing they can run with anyone in the conference. Claire running the fastest time in program history is really special. And to have her roommate, friend and fellow captain alongside her running the second-best in program history is pretty cool." Â
Siena will be back in competition at the 2025 MAAC Outdoor Track and Field Championships on Saturday, May 10 and Sunday, May 11 from Rider University. Â
